Output 1042c8f8b8314b0468632012a2f68316c95ad7d65e0525c6a85de9a24f7048c9:1

value
31074310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f6308859ae9278d3af3ee827d822cfabe94b26 OP_EQUALVERIFY OP_CHECKSIG
address
1MEdFwttYYfLXEAGJuhUEfzXsnzaJb6eTv
transaction
1042c8f8b8314b0468632012a2f68316c95ad7d65e0525c6a85de9a24f7048c9
spent
true